What is the difference between Weekend Machine Vision Engineer vs Weekend Robotics Technician?

AspectWeekend Machine Vision EngineerWeekend Robotics Technician
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Engineering, Computer Science, or related field; knowledge of image processing and programmingAssociate's or Bachelor's in Robotics, Electronics, or related field; hands-on technical skills
Work EnvironmentTech labs, manufacturing facilities, or research centers focusing on vision systemsManufacturing floors, maintenance workshops, or field service settings
Industry UsageManufacturing, automation, quality controlManufacturing, assembly lines, equipment maintenance

The Weekend Machine Vision Engineer primarily focuses on developing and implementing vision systems for automation and quality control, requiring programming and image processing skills. In contrast, the Weekend Robotics Technician handles maintenance and troubleshooting of robotic systems, emphasizing hands-on technical skills. Both roles are essential in manufacturing environments but differ in their focus and daily tasks.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Weekend Machine Vision Engineer, and why are they important?

To excel as a Weekend Machine Vision Engineer, you typically need a background in computer vision, image processing, and a degree in engineering, computer science, or a related field. Familiarity with programming languages like Python or C++, experience with machine vision libraries (such as OpenCV or Halcon), and knowledge of industrial camera systems are commonly required.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ure the development and maintenance of reliable vision systems that support high-quality automation and manufacturing processes during critical weekend operations.

What does a Weekend Machine Vision Engineer do?

A Weekend Machine Vision Engineer is responsible for developing, testing, and maintaining computer vision systems that enable machines to interpret and process visual data. This role typically involves working weekends to support production lines or R&D projects that need ongoing monitoring and updates outside of standard business hours. Key tasks include programming vision algorithms, integrating cameras and sensors, troubleshooting system issues, and collaborating with other engineers to improve automation and quality control processes. Weekend Machine Vision Engineers are commonly found in manufacturing, robotics, and quality assurance environments that require continuous technical support.

What are some common challenges faced by a Weekend Machine Vision Engineer, and how can they be addressed?

As a Weekend Machine Vision Engineer, you may encounter challenges such as troubleshooting unexpected equipment malfunctions, adapting to rapidly changing production needs, and working with limited on-site support compared to weekday shifts. To address these, it's important to develop strong problem-solving skills, stay up-to-date with the latest software and hardware updates, and maintain clear documentation for seamless communication with weekday teams. Proactively coordinating with colleagues during shift handovers and leveraging remote support resources can also help ensure smooth operations and minimize downtime.
